حَدَّثَنَا
زَكَرِيَّاءُ بْنُ يَحْيَى أَبُو السُّكَيْنِ ، قَالَ : حَدَّثَنَا
الْمُحَارِبِيُّ ، قَالَ : حَدَّثَنَا
مُحَمَّدُ بْنُ سُوقَةَ ، عَنْ
سَعِيدِ بْنِ جُبَيْرٍ ، قَالَ : " كُنْتُ مَعَ
ابْنِ عُمَرَ حِينَ أَصَابَهُ سِنَانُ الرُّمْحِ فِي أَخْمَصِ قَدَمِهِ ، فَلَزِقَتْ قَدَمُهُ بِالرِّكَابِ فَنَزَلْتُ فَنَزَعْتُهَا وَذَلِكَ بِمِنًى فَبَلَغَ الْحَجَّاجَ فَجَعَلَ يَعُودُهُ ، فَقَالَ الْحَجَّاجُ : لَوْ نَعْلَمُ مَنْ أَصَابَكَ ، فَقَالَ ابْنُ عُمَرَ : أَنْتَ أَصَبْتَنِي ، قَالَ : وَكَيْفَ ؟ قَالَ : حَمَلْتَ السِّلَاحَ فِي يَوْمٍ لَمْ يَكُنْ يُحْمَلُ فِيهِ ، وَأَدْخَلْتَ السِّلَاحَ الْحَرَمَ وَلَمْ يَكُنِ السِّلَاحُ يُدْخَلُ الْحَرَمَ " .
Narrated Sa`id bin Jubair: I was with Ibn `Umar when a spear head pierced the sole of his foot and his foot stuck to the paddle of the saddle and I got down and pulled his foot out, and that happened in Mina. Al-Hajjaj got the news and came to inquire about his health and said, "Alas! If we could only know the man who wounded you!" Ibn `Umar said, "You are the one who wounded me." Al-Hajjaj said, "How is that?" Ibn `Umar said, "You have allowed the arms to be carried on a day on which nobody used to carry them and you allowed arms to be carried in the Haram even though it was not allowed before."
